Common Wildlife Issues in DuPage County

Wildlife infestations in DuPage County commonly result from animals burrowing into homes to seek shelter and food. This can lead to various issues, including:

  1. Attic Damage: Raccoons, bats, birds, and squirrels often cause significant damage to attic insulation, vents, and air ducts. This not only compromises the structural integrity of the property but also creates biohazardous situations due to animal waste, posing health risks such as diseases, parasites, and respiratory issues.
  2. Odor and Health Risks: The presence of animal waste in insulation can lead to foul odors and health hazards. It is essential to address these issues promptly to prevent further damage, improve air quality, and eliminate health risks.
  3. Energy Inefficiency: Wildlife infestations can also lead to energy inefficiency, as compromised insulation and ventilation systems can impact the overall energy efficiency of a property. This can result in increased energy costs and decreased comfort in living spaces.

Is It Legal to Trap and Relocate Raccoons in Illinois?

Raccoon relocation is illegal in Illinois, as per state wildlife laws. Trapping and relocating raccoons is against regulations set by the Illinois Department of Natural Resources. The Illinois Wildlife Code prohibits relocation without a special permit. Professional wildlife control services are trained to adhere to legal requirements for raccoon removal in Illinois, ensuring humane and legal wildlife management. Urban wildlife, including nuisance animals like raccoons, should be handled in compliance with state laws.

Do You Have to Register Your Dog in Dupage County?

Yes, dog registration in DuPage County is a requirement. It helps ensure responsible pet ownership, population control, and provides crucial information to animal control services. Failure to register can result in fines. The process involves providing proof of rabies vaccination and paying a fee. Exemptions may apply for service dogs. Public awareness and education campaigns promote compliance. Overall, registration is important for the safety of pets and the community.

How Do I Get a Rabies Tag in Dupage County?

To obtain a rabies tag in DuPage County, pets must be vaccinated by a licensed veterinarian. The tag is typically provided at the time of vaccination. This process ensures compliance with local pet ownership regulations and promotes public health and safety by identifying vaccinated pets.
